Canadian Paediatric Society, Ottawa (Ontario). – 1994
Written by pediatricians, this book is designed to bring vital health information to caregivers providing child care in their homes. It provides caregivers with practical answers to common questions about children's health, safety, and well-being. The guide is divided in six sections. The Health section contains a simple practical strategy for…

Connecticut Birth to Three System, Hartford. – 1998
This document presents guidelines for differential diagnosis and eligibility determination under Connecticut's Birth to Three System for young children with communication problems, usually delayed speech. An executive summary presents a rationale and recommendation locator in the form of a matrix of communication problems, the eligibility…

Gundlach, Robert A. – 1982
A synthesis of current research, theory, and professional opinion on how children learn to write, this report begins with a brief introduction followed by a discussion of writing readiness that suggests children's eagerness to learn to write. The third chapter examines children's use of writing to extend the functions of speech, drawing, and play,…
